Yeah, stop claiming silly claims. CGMiner has a reporting error according to kano. 2x Spartans cannot run at 1GH/s short of melting the boards or a major advancement in the bitstreams. The original seller, blackarrow here (https://bitcointalk.org/index.php?topic=187549.0) only claimed 400 HM/s because it's what the boards can do.

PS: I'm currently running 10 x4 Spartan boards at a grand total of around 8.8 GH/s .

Warning added to deter noobs falling.

The escrow address for Jimmy2011's Avalon Chip group buy is:

134X8uG2Lnybny44Mbmqx99uBubuomsZY4

Please state and agree to the conditions (if item is received damaged, item lost with tracking, customs fee etc) beforehand.

If possible, GPG sign your agreement to prevent any discrepancies later on and please ship with tracking to prevent problems during delivery.
GPG signing is not a requirement, and any verbal exchange in the form of private messages or posts on bitcointalk.org, or email is effective as a statement of condition.

Do note that I am only responsible for the funds up to the point it is sent to Avalon.
Any losses incurred by Avalon's or Jimmy2011's failure to ship/reship will not be borne by me, but I will release the following data to aid in litigation actions.

In addition to that, I confirm the receipt of:

1) Jimmy2011's ID
2) Self-potrait of Jimmy2011 via cellphone camera


The fine print:
This Contract is solely generated for the purpose of facilitating the transaction between the seller and the buyer, which refers to the pseudonyms used on bitcointalk.org.
The escrow holder, John, assumes and gives no liability or guarantees on the satisfaction of all parties involved, although he agrees to mediate and facilitate the deal to the fullest extent he is capable of.  On the event that any problems arises, he will release the escrow to whichever party that presents him with the most convincing proof and/or after an open discussion with others or theymos. 
The verbal acceptance by both parties (or the failure to reject) and the sending of Bitcoins to the escrow address above constitutes the acceptance of the terms and conditions stated, and the activation of this Contract.

Please understand that I am assuming the risk of holding the escrowed Bitcoins, and I am using my own time to facilitate this transaction.   
I am imposing a fixed and nonrefundable fee of 2% for this transaction, to be deducted when the funds are moved.

It's a great shame that the United States government shut down Liberty Reserve, but it should come as no surprise given what they did to e-gold and the fact that Costa Rica has very close ties to the US government.  After I lost a lot of gold held by US-based e-gold when they were seized by US authorities six years ago, I spent some time looking for alternatives which were based in jurisdictions without close ties to the United States, with no history of caving in to demands by the US or other G7 countries, and with a decent rule of law.  C-gold based in Malaysia quickly rose to the top of my list.  I traveled to Malaysia and met the operator of C-gold before starting a relationship with them and he seemed competent and experienced at running businesses, so my decision was easy.  I have enjoyed a problem-free relationship with them since 2007.  Pecunix is another popular digital gold currency I evaluated, but they are based in Panama which like Costa Rica is subject to undue influence by the United States so I would be uncomfortable keeping significant holdings with them.

Disclaimer:  I am a satisfied customer of c-gold, and a former (also satisfied) customer of Pecunix.  I'm also currently selling a portion of my c-gold holdings to buy bitcoins in another thread, so make of that what you will.


Okay, this is news to me that c-gold is based in Malaysia.   Undecided I'm afraid that Malaysia isn't that free as you would think - the government has seized a couple of such companies in the past.

Just got my tracking number from Arklan! So, to recap:
- ASICMiner only sold these in lots of 300, which none of us could afford (or chose not to) individually, so we needed a group buy; none of us stepped up to organize this, but Arklan did
- Arklan's group buy was the first to complete, thus making us the first batch to ship, thus making us the first on earth to get to play with these
- Arklan has been pleasant and organized throughout
- While it is arguable that the first batch might not have been re-shipped as fast as humanly imaginable, that hypothetical loss of .013BTC revenue for one day -- we're talking a cup of coffee here -- isn't hurting any of the buyers -- especially taking into account how far ahead of the other group buys we are -- and the only person complaining is a guy who isn't in the first batch anyway, so it doesn't even effect him.
